Job Description

Geode Capital Management, LLC (“GCM”) is a global institutional asset manager providing core beta exposures across a range of equity and niche asset classes, including commodities and options, for registered funds, commingled pools and separately managed accounts. Geode currently manages over $1.5 trillion in AUM across the products it advises and sub-advises.

Geode is looking for a highly motivated Senior Manager, Communications to lead communications and employee engagement initiatives across the firm. Reporting to the Head of Human Resources, this is unique opportunity to develop and implement internal communication plans that effectively engage employees and enhance Geode’s organizational culture. As the voice of internal communications, the Senior Manager, Communications will align communication efforts with Geode’s business objectives which is critical in driving employee engagement and supporting our overall HR initiatives.

This role is based out of our office in Boston, Massachusetts and is required to follow the firm’s current hybrid work schedule: Tuesday, Wednesday and Thursday in-office, with the option to work Monday and Friday remote from home.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Create and lead the execution of an internal communication plan that aligns with Geode’s strategic objectives, ensuring consistent and effective messaging across the organization
  • Draft, edit, produce and distribute engaging content for internal channels including newsletters, intranet, digital signage, emails, Microsoft Teams and internal meetings
  • Partner with leaders across the organization to determine communication needs for individual groups, ensuring holistic alignment and integration of communication efforts
  • Produce visual content, including infographics, Microsoft PowerPoint presentations and videos, to enhance the employee experience
  • Provide support and guidance to senior leadership on internal communication strategies, including internal presentations, written communications and meetings
  • Create and manage an annual communications and events calendar, partnering with Geode’s Employee Resource Groups (ERG’s)
  • Partner with Human Resources on employee engagement initiatives such as reward and recognition programs
  • Work closely with Geode’s Legal and Compliance teams to ensure all communications adhere to regulatory standards

Skills You Bring

  • 8+ years’ experience in corporate communications, including internal and executive communications
  • Demonstrated ability to develop and execute innovative communication strategies
  • Expertise in project management
  • Strong copy-editing skills and attention to detail, along with an outstanding ability to translate ideas into clear messaging
  • Ability to build relationships and work across all levels and functions
  • Adept at coordinating multiple projects simultaneously ensuring timely delivery while maintaining high quality and creativity
  • Experience with Microsoft Office, specifically PowerPoint & Word expertise, SharePoint, and Adobe Creative Suite
  • Experience using digital communication tools and platforms to enhance messaging and drive engagement
  • Self-starter with the ability to work independently

More About Geode

Founded in 2001, Geode is headquartered in Boston’s financial district, the center of one of the world’s most vibrant finance and technology hubs and employs approximately 180 employees. With a robust infrastructure and experienced investment professionals, Geode offers the scale of a large asset management firm with the benefits of a smaller organization.
